Kinds Of Glass Window Damage
Understanding the different types of damage can assist homeowners decide the best strategy for repair. Below is a table describing numerous kinds of glass window concerns frequently came across.
Kind of DamageDescriptionPotential CausesCracksSurface fractures that do not extend all the way through the glass.Temperature level modifications, pressureShattered GlassGlass that is totally broken, typically leaving shards.Impact, mishapsFoggy WindowsCondensation caught in between double or triple-pane glass.Stopped working seal, wetness ingressChips and DentsLittle chips or damages in the glass surface area.Flying particles, hail stormsBroken SealsLoss of gas in between panes leading to diminished insulation.Age, pressure changesTypical Causes of Glass Window Damage
There are a number of elements that can lead to glass window damage, consisting of:
Weather Conditions: Extreme temperature levels and weather patterns can lead to thermal stress on window glass.Accidental Impacts: Sports, yard upkeep, and even garden debris can create unanticipated impacts.Wear and Tear: Over time, natural wear can deteriorate the glass and its seals.Incorrect Installation: Poorly installed windows are more susceptible to harm from external components.Poor Maintenance: Neglecting routine maintenance can cause undetected damage that gets worse gradually.DIY Glass Window Repair Techniques
For minor repair work, house owners might select to deal with the job themselves. Here's a list of typical DIY methods for fixing glass windows.
1. Fixing Small CracksMaterials Needed: Glass repair resin, razor blade, alcohol wipes.Instructions:Clean the area around the crack with alcohol wipes.Inject the glass repair resin into the fracture utilizing the applicator.Utilize a razor blade to smooth the resin flush with the glass surface area.Allow it to treat for the recommended time.2. Repairing Broken SealsMaterials Needed: Silicone sealant, caulking weapon, utility knife.Instructions:Remove the old sealant utilizing an utility knife.Tidy the location completely.Apply new silicone sealant around the boundary.Smooth out the sealant with your finger or a smoothing tool.3. Changing a Single Pane of GlassMaterials Needed: Replacement glass, glazing putty, Certified Glazier points, energy knife.Guidelines:Remove the window sash and old glass.Step and cut the replacement glass to fit.Insert the new glass, protecting it with glazier points.Apply glazing putty around the edges to seal it in place.4. Handling Foggy WindowsMaterials Needed: Absorbent cloth, hairdryer (optional).Directions:Assess whether the windows require to be changed completely (often needed for double/triple panes).If safe, use a hairdryer to clear condensation briefly, however note this does not fix the concern.Do it yourself RepairsEffectivenessAbility LevelExpenseLittle CracksModerateIntermediateLowBroken SealsModerateNoviceLowSingle Pane ReplacementHighAdvancedModerate to HighFoggy WindowsShort-livedNewbieLowWhen to Call a Professional
While DIY repair work can be reliable for small issues, there are times when professional assistance is needed:
Extensive Damage: For significant cracks or shatters, it's best to leave the repair to professionals.Numerous Panels: If a number of panes are broken or fogged, hiring a professional can save time and ensure safety.Structural Issues: If the Window Glass Replacement frame is harmed or jeopardized, a professional should assess the circumstance.Expenses Associated with Glass Window Repair

Yes, little cracks and chips can frequently be fixed using DIY sets. Nevertheless, bigger issues or total damages may require professional aid.
2. For how long does glass repair take?
Small repairs can frequently be finished within a few hours, while full replacements might take a day or more, depending upon the window type and condition.
3. Is it worth fixing foggy windows?
If the fogging is due to a broken seal, it might be more economical to change the entire system, particularly for double or triple-paned windows.
4. How can I prevent future glass damage?
Routine maintenance, such as cleaning seamless gutters and trimming trees, together with careful handling of outdoor activities, can help avoid damage to windows.
